Hi, Eric

If the crash occurs right when the fax service begins to receive, you may try to do the following:

- In the Configuration Panel, go to Settings/Advanced page, on the first ("Advanced") tab
- there, in the "Settings for Direct SIP calls", please check if the "Local SIP domain" field is set to "mysipdomain.com" or any other domain name.
- if yes, then replace it with an IP (if you're not interested at this moment in direct SIP calls, you may specify 127.0.0.1)
- restart 3CXPhoneSystem and then the fax service.
- try again to receive a fax.

We found very recently, in the fax service, a bug matching quite well the "simptoms" you described, so it might be.
